Internal Receptors

Many cellular signals are hydrophilic and therefore cannot pass through the plasma membrane. However, small or hydrophobic signaling molecules can cross the hydrophobic core of the plasma membrane and bind to internal, or intracellular, receptors that reside within the cell. Many mammalian steroid hormones use this mechanism of cell signaling, as does nitric oxide (NO) gas.

Area of Science:

  • Medical imaging
  • Diagnostic ultrasound
  • Clinical research

Background:

  • The 31st Dreiländertreffen was expanded to include the European Federation of Societies for Ultrasound in Medicine and Biology (EFSUMB).
  • This review evaluates the impact of international participation and identifies key areas of advancement in ultrasound diagnostics.

Framework:

  • The Dreiländertreffen serves as a platform for advanced training and scientific exchange in ultrasound diagnostics.
  • International collaboration aimed to enrich the meeting's scientific content and scope.

Implementation:

  • Contributions highlighted contrast agent sonography for liver tumor diagnosis (DEGUM multicenter study).
  • Monitoring of interventional stent implantation for aortic aneurysms and angiogenesis inhibition in cancer treatment were key topics.
  • The review identified a need for more large-scale prospective studies to validate clinical applications.

Implications:

  • Enhanced international participation provided valuable insights but did not address the core issue of limited prospective validation studies.
  • There is a need for greater emphasis on the scientific component of the Dreiländertreffen to strengthen ultrasound diagnostics.
  • Scientific advancements in ultrasound are crucial for its role in clinical health care research and the future of professional associations.
